全面解析V2Ray集群转发

现代网络环境中,许多用户为了实现科学上网网络匿名,纷纷选择使用V2Ray。V2Ray作为一种灵活且强大的网络代理工具,支持多种协议和传输方式。本篇文章将重点讨论V2Ray集群转发,解析其工作原理、配置方法及常见问题,帮助用户更好地利用这一强大工具。

什么是V2Ray集群转发?

V2Ray集群转发是指将多个V2Ray节点组合在一起,通过一个集群的方式进行数据转发,从而提升网络的稳定性和速度。集群转发不仅能有效分散用户请求的负载,还能实现流量的智能调度,提升用户的访问体验。

V2Ray集群转发的优势

  • 负载均衡:通过集群转发,可以实现对多个节点的负载均衡,避免单个节点过载。
  • 高可用性:当某个节点出现故障时,集群中的其他节点可以无缝接管流量,确保服务的高可用性。
  • 优化网络性能:根据实时网络状况,动态选择最佳节点,提高连接速度。

V2Ray集群转发的基本架构

V2Ray集群转发通常由多个V2Ray节点和一个负载均衡器组成。负载均衡器负责接收用户请求,并将请求分发至各个V2Ray节点。

1. V2Ray节点

V2Ray节点是执行数据转发的基础部分,每个节点都有自己独特的配置和协议。

2. 负载均衡器

负载均衡器可以是硬件设备,也可以是软件解决方案,如Nginx或HAProxy。负载均衡器负责智能调度,将流量分发至健康的V2Ray节点。

如何配置V2Ray集群转发

配置V2Ray集群转发的过程相对复杂,需涉及多个组件。下面是详细的步骤:

第一步:搭建V2Ray节点

在每台服务器上安装并配置V2Ray,确保每个节点都可以正常工作。可以按照以下步骤进行:

  1. 下载并安装V2Ray。
  2. 配置V2Ray的config.json文件,设置端口、协议等信息。
  3. 启动V2Ray服务,确保其正常运行。

第二步:配置负载均衡器

以Nginx为例,配置负载均衡器的方法如下:

  1. 安装Nginx。

  2. 编辑Nginx配置文件,添加V2Ray节点信息: nginx http { upstream v2ray { server 192.168.1.2:1080; server 192.168.1.3:1080; server 192.168.1.4:1080; } server { listen 80; location / { proxy_pass http://v2ray; } } }

  3. 重启Nginx,使配置生效。

第三步:进行流量监控和优化

使用工具监控V2Ray节点的流量和性能,根据实时数据进行优化。例如,可以根据节点的负载状况调整负载均衡策略。

常见问题解答(FAQ)

V2Ray集群转发是否安全?

是的,V2Ray使用多种加密方式,能够有效保护用户数据传输的安全性。此外,搭建集群的负载均衡可以让数据流更加隐蔽,提升网络的安全性。

如何判断哪个V2Ray节点性能最佳?

可以使用一些网络测速工具,或者通过V2Ray的内置统计功能监控每个节点的流量和延迟,选择最佳节点。

需要多少服务器来搭建V2Ray集群?

这取决于您的实际需求和流量情况。一般来说,至少需要两台以上的服务器来实现基本的负载均衡,但为了增强稳定性,建议使用三台或更多的服务器。

如何处理V2Ray节点故障?

可以通过负载均衡器动态监测各个节点的健康状态。当某个节点出现故障时,负载均衡器自动将流量转至其他正常的节点。

总结

V2Ray集群转发是一种有效的网络优化方式,能够提供高可用性和负载均衡的解决方案。通过合理的配置和监控,用户可以充分发挥V2Ray的优势,提高网络访问的效率和安全性。希望本文能够帮助读者更好地理解和使用V2Ray集群转发。

正文完
 0